El salario real variará según la ubicación, calificaciones, habilidades y experiencia del candidato.Información sobre beneficios puede ser encontrada aquí.WHO WE ARE LOOKING FOR Nike’s Creative Operations team seeks a skilled Post Producer to join our expanding Post-Production function. The ideal candidate will have experience working in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ment, with strong written & verbal communication skills and experience collaborating with a team of post-production artists across still and video production, shoot producers, creative stakeholders, partner agencies and asset managers. The individual will have in-depth knowledge of both still and video post-production workflows and serve as the project’s direct liaison responsible for facilitating and delivering a seamless, timely, and accurate Post-Production finishing process.WHAT YOU WILL WORK ON If this is you, you’ll be working with the Post-Production team on high-caliber Nike brand marketing projects. As Post Producer, you will oversee the creation of brand assets (still & video) and ensure on-time delivery of all assigned post-production projects. You will support with providing, managing, and organizing creative and technical direction for post-production campaigns to remove obstacles and avoid post-production related blockers. This role will support with the creation of project estimates, budget tracking, and schedule management and the successful candidate will have strong technical, creative and organizational skills with knowledge of the Adobe suite of products, specifically Premiere, Photoshop, Camera Raw, Lightroom, Bridge, Indesign, Illustrator, After Effects, Media Encoder etc. Additionally, you’ll be asked to escalate production challenges to the function’s Post-Production Director, maintain post-production tracking and ensure all deliverables meet specified quality standards.WHO YOU WILL WORK WITH You will be responsible for providing assistance and support to internal team leaders in post-production, such as the Video Manager and Lead Campaign Retoucher, Creative Producers and other studio stakeholders. This support will be essential for the successful execution of brand creative campaigns, projects, and workstreams, all under the leadership of the Post-Production Director and the guidance of the Post Operations Manager.WHAT YOU BRING

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education, experience or training.5+ years of relevant experience in a marketing post-production facility specializing in post-production workflows and project management.Excellent understanding of the whole production pipeline from pre-production through post and finishing.Adheres to best practices for quality control and oversees the delivery of finished materials to the end destination.
